Most CDNs have object size limits so the setup cascades through different levels of completely different systems to cope with our large object sizes.=C2=A0The CDNs themselves are not designed for large objects either, in their view we should split these into multiple smaller objects. That isn't really possible without rewriting the way bitbake works with sstate. Objects are only pulled into the CDN at first request too, the larger the objects, the longer this takes. The setup has changed a bit as we've tried to work out how we can make it work. One issue was the size of the "pipe" between our servers and the CDN nodes. The new infrastructure/data centre location has resolved that potential bottleneck. Cheers, Richard
